A/C blowing hot air

1997 Max SE with auto climate control, AC had been working fine now it's suddenly blowing hot air. When I turn on AC, compressor kicks on, belt is intact, both rad fans turn on, Low pressure line is ice cold. What do I check next?

Get down in the passenger side footwell. Remove the plastic cover that covers the end of the ECU. Turn on the ignition key (you don't have to start the car if you don't want to). Watch the little arm right over the ECU as you change the temperature setting on the heater control panel back and forth from 65ºF to 85ºF.

If the arm doesn't move, the motor that moves it is bad. It is called the Air Mix Door Motor.

If the arm moves, run the self diagnostic and see what the results are. To run the diagnostic, follow the directions that start on page 70.

If the low pressure side is cold, the system is working fine. Still, verify you have correct line pressure.

If pressures are good, then you air mix door is fubar like Dennis said. Check operation of the door. U can usually hear the door open and close when u cycle air temp from cold to hot.
